New Insights into the Chemical Composition, Pro-Inflammatory Cytokine Inhibition Profile of Davana (Artemisia pallens Wall. ex DC.) Essential Oil and cis-Davanone in Primary Macrophage Cells

Swati Singh et al.

Summary: This study developed a chemical profile of davana essential oil using various analytical techniques, identifying ninety-nine compounds with cis-davanone as the major component. Additionally, several novel minor components were discovered, enhancing the authenticity determination of davana essential oil.
